Jury Trial on Terra Vs SEC Reaches Final Stage

Attorneys representing Terraform Labs and co-founder Do Kwon are set to give their final arguments in front of the jury, reported Reuters on April 5.

The U.S. SEC accused Terraform Labs and Do Kwon of defrauding investors which caused the $60 billion Terra-LUNA crisis in 2022. The SEC alleges that Terraform misled investors about stability and TerraUSD (UST), an algorithmic stablecoin. Also, the SEC argues defendants falsely claimed Terra blockchain use in another co-founder Daniel Shin’s mobile payment app Chai Corp.

Defense attorneys argued that the SEC’s claims were out of context from wrong statements and relied on witnesses aimed to get whistleblower payouts if the SEC emerges victorious in the lawsuit.

The securities regulator seeks penalties, fines, and orders that TFL and Do Kwon violated securities laws. Meanwhile, Do Kwon didn’t attend the jury trial, which started on March 25, as Montenegro and South Korean authorities planned to extradite Do Kwon to South Korea.

Judge Provides Jury Instructions

Judge Rakoff provided the jury with a brief overview of the US SEC lawsuit against Terraform Labs and Do Kwon. Also, the detailed jury instructions will replace earlier preliminary instructions after all evidence and closing arguments are presented by both parties.

The SEC during the lawsuit and jury trial mentioned how Do Kwon and Terraform Labs secretly transferred funds outside the company, used arrangements to prop up the prices of Terra and LUNA, and lied to its investors.

Brian Curran, the former head of communications at Terraform Labs, testified against Terra and disclosed the company’s misleading practices.
